ANNOUNCEMENT:

We are pleased to announce a partnership with bmoney to bring a multi-service global payment solution to BillaryCoin. Utilizing the backend money services of Global Payments Card Inc. and Paymaster Canada, BLRY will be spendable at the point-of-sale utilizing the Android and IOS Paymaster app, and physical payment cards. The Paymaster app is powered by Pyx Payments, a world leader in mobile payment solutions. We at Team Billary couldn’t be happier to be the first additional alt-coin to be accepted using the bmoney payment system.

The full details of the upcoming launch of bmoney can be seen at https://bitcointalk.org/index.php?topic=1632292

We will release more details about this partnership in the coming weeks. Including the exact specifics on how you can actually spend your BLRY at hundreds of thousands of point-of-sale locations around the world,  Stay tuned.

BLRY Technical Specifications

PoW Algorithm: Scrypt
PoW Phase: 8,900,000
Block time: 1 Minute
Amount of coins per block: 100 coins
PoW Phase Duration: 150,000 blocks
Block Maturity Time: 20 blocks
PoS Interest: 5%
Premine: 2%
Transaction confirmations: Lightning-fast 5 block confirmations
Min Stake Age: 8 hours
